Cheetos pretzels? A look at the cheese snack's venture into new taste category
View
Date:2025-04-17 23:39:07
Cheetos has its own take on the traditional pretzels and cheese sauce snack: new Cheetos Pretzels.
The treat, now hitting stores, comes in two flavors: Cheetos Pretzels Cheddar and Cheetos Pretzels Flamin' Hot.
Each piece has one side that looks like pretzel, made of crispy wheat, while the other is covered in "Cheetle" powdered cheese flavor.
They can be purchased at stores nationwide for $5.69 in 10-ounce bags and $2.49 in 3-ounce bags.
Cheetos isn't a newbie when it comes to experimenting with new combinations. Three years ago its Cheetos Mac 'n Cheese received a lot of attention and launched in three flavors: Bold & Cheesy, Flamin’ Hot and Cheesy Jalapeño.

New limited release snacks
If you are a Cheetos junkie, there's more to explore among its other new limited release snacks. They include Cheetos Flamin’ Hot Cinnamon Sugar Popcorn, plus all these different flavors of Cheetos: Flamin’ Hot Smoky Ghost Pepper, White Cheddar Bag of Bones, Cinnamon Sugar Bag of Bones, Crunchy Nashville Hot, and Crunchy Flamin’ Hot Tangy Chili Fusion.
Cheetos' parent company Frito-Lay decided to venture into pretzel territory because it found 63% of Cheetos consumers were also buying pretzels and that flavored pretzels have been driving 58% of the pretzel sales growth.
"Our fans are always hungry for unique ways that they can experience Cheetos' signature cheesy flavor, which is why this latest innovation is breaking into an entirely new category," said Tina Mahal, Frito-Lay's senior vice president of marketing, in a press release. "Cheetos pretzels maximize the fan-favorite seasoning in each bite with the perfect product texture, ultimately bringing the Cheetos flavor experience to life in pretzel form."
